What are Drama Club Classes at Upstage Theatre Schools?
Over the past few years, we’ve recognized a growing need for deeper connection within our Upstage family. Our students share a strong love of performance and theatre, and many are building friendships with peers from surrounding schools. We realized that one 2-hour program each week doesn’t always feel like enough time for students to connect over something they’re so passionate about.
Enter: Drama Club! This year, we’re excited to introduce our brand-new Drama Club Classes at The Pico—designed for young performers looking for more Upstage. This class will likely divide into two age groups based on enrollment and will focus on the foundational building blocks of acting through scene study and performance technique. Students will develop their skills through partner and group scenes, character development exercises, monologue work, and other acting-focused activities designed to strengthen confidence and stage presence. Improvisation will also be incorporated through games and interactive exercises that encourage creativity, collaboration, and quick thinking. This is a true acting and drama skills class focusing on performance technique and storytelling. It has no musical theatre component.
